Once the patient is in remission, additional treatment is necessary to increase the chance of a long remission or cure for the disease. While in remission, small numbers of leukemia cells may remain in the bone marrow at such low levels that they are not easily detectable. Post-remission treatment can help to prevent these cells from growing back and causing a recurrence of the disease.
The type and intensity of post-remission chemotherapy will depend on a number of factors, including the result of the cytogenics testing at the time of diagnosis, the age of the patient, and the patient’s response to the treatment used.
In many cases, a patient may undergo a repeated course of post-remission chemotherapy. These treatments are often similar in intensity to the induction chemotherapy and require a hospital stay of a few weeks.
